Über Orazio Julio
15+ Jahre Expertise in Software-Entwicklung, Cloud-Architekturen & Team-Leadership
Deutsch
Muttersprachlich oder zweisprachig
Englisch
Verhandlungssicher
Projekt- und Berufserfahrung
- Digital TraceTeam Lead Development, Senior Software EngineerSOZIALE NETZWERKEFebruar 2023 - September 2025 (2 Jahre und 7 Monate)Düsseldorf, DeutschlandUpon joining a mid-sized marketing company with approximately 15 employees—including a five-person IT team—I was confronted with a highly unstructured and chaotic environment. Taking the initiative, I introduced and established clear development and organizational processes. This included setting up JIRA for task and project management, Confluence for centralized documentation, and implementing a standardized git-flow branching strategy for source control.I also took full ownership of the company’s AWS cloud infrastructure, which was initially disorganized and hard to manage. By restructuring and optimizing the setup, I significantly improved transparency, security, and maintainability across the environment.On the development side, I introduced React as the company’s new standard frontend framework, enabling faster, more scalable development and better maintainability of the codebase. In parallel, I supported the full lifecycle of a new digital product—from the initial idea and business case validation to development, launch, and go-to-market readiness—bridging the gap between business goals and technical execution.Beyond hands-on technical work, I was also responsible for leading the IT department, mentoring team members, and driving a professional and collaborative team culture.
- SPITCH GmbHDirector Blockchain and NFT TechnologiesSPORTMärz 2022 - Januar 2023 (11 Monate)Dortmund, DeutschlandBeing responsible for the Blockchain and NFT project as part of the SPITCH Team, I was heavily involved in developing a business idea and business case for a new product for SPITCH.After the process of developing that idea and the case for the new product, several iterative stages of proving the feasibility of that idea had to be undergone. Those processes involved the conduct of market research, developing mathematical simulations to test the robustness of the financial stability of the idea as well as creating documents and presentations to share the idea in an understandable manner with the stakeholders.Once that procedure was finished and the stakeholders were convinced of the viability of the business case, the technology stack and system architecture had to be established. For scalability reasons, I have decided to go ahead with a microservice architecture based on the JavaScript framework NestJS, which is based on NodeJS, for the server implementation, PostgreSQL for the database, Flutter for the Smartphone application and Kafka as messaging system for the microservices. On top of that, every microservice was encapsulated in a Docker container for flexible deployment on the Google's Cloud Platform, which were orchestrated via Kubernetes.To maximize performance, scalability and security, the implementation of the code was based on the CQRS pattern. This architecture enabled the team to scalable develop and deploy the solution for future use.Sadly, the company had to file for bankruptcy in November 2022.
- Diebold NixdorfSenior Solution Architect, Security SpecialistBANKEN & VERSICHERUNGENJuli 2019 - Februar 2022 (2 Jahre und 8 Monate)Paderborn, DeutschlandAfter my versatile experience at Diebold Nixdorf in Bracknell, UK (formerly Wincor Nixdorf), I moved back to Germany, Dortmund to start a new position at the HQ of Diebold Nixdorf in Paderborn.At my new career path, I started to take over some of the most complex and complicated parts of our software solution, which is the implementation of the exchange of symmetric and asymmetric keys with ATMs, also known as Remote Key Loading (“RKL”). Due to my specialization in this field of security related topics, I am working in several ongoing projects supporting the architects with my knowledge for specifications, developers for the implementation and testers with their scripts.Furthermore, am I supervising the continuous integration (“CI”) and continuous development (“CD”) as well as development processes of these projects due to my previous experience.To share my general system architecture, banking infrastructure and Diebold Nixdorf product related knowledge, I was assigned to create and hold training lessons internally, for customers at the bank as well as for suppliers using our software.
Empfehlungen
Sei die erste Person, die Orazio Julio empfiehlt
Teile Deine Erfahrung aus der Zusammenarbeit mit diesem Freelancer.
Diese Freelancer passen auch zu Ihren Kriterien
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Ausbildung und Abschlüsse
- Extra-occupational study of economics and computer sciencethe FOM in Dortmund2015Extra-occupational study of economics and computer science
- IT-expert in System-integration.2010IT-expert in System-integration.